PACEVIT B INJECTION 1ML belongs to the class of nutritional supplements primarily used to treat nutritional deficiencies. Nutritional deficiency occurs when the body cannot absorb or get enough nutrients from food. It could lead to various health problems, including defective bone growth, skin disorders, digestive issues, and dementia (memory loss).
PACEVIT B INJECTION 1ML contains Folic acid, Mecobalamin, and Nicotinamide. Folic acid helps form red blood cells and prevents DNA changes that may lead to cancer. Mecobalamin/Methylcobalamin/Vitamin B12 regulates body functions, such as cell multiplication, blood formation, and protein synthesis. Nicotinamide helps replenish the energy in the body cells and provides essential nutrients.
Your doctor will decide the duration based on your medical condition. Sometimes, PACEVIT B INJECTION 1ML may cause common side effects like nausea, upset stomach, and diarrhoea. These side effects do not require medical attention and gradually resolve over time. However, if the side effects are persistent, please contact your doctor.
Let your doctor know if you are using prescription or non-prescription drugs and herbal products before starting PACEVIT B INJECTION 1ML. If you are known to be allergic to any of the components in PACEVIT B INJECTION 1ML, please inform your doctor. If you are pregnant or breastfeeding, please consult your doctor before taking PACEVIT B INJECTION 1ML. Avoid alcohol absorption since it may interfere with the absorption of PACEVIT B INJECTION 1ML. This injection is not recommended for newborns or infants.

Inform your doctor know if you have a medical history of bleeding problems (low platelets), diabetes, gout, liver/kidney diseases, pernicious anaemia, and stomach ulcer problems. Pregnant or breastfeeding women should consult their doctor before taking PACEVIT B INJECTION 1ML. Excessive alcohol consumption reduces the absorption and increases the elimination of folic acid. It is not recommended to consume alcohol while being treated with PACEVIT B INJECTION 1ML.
Drug-Drug Interaction: PACEVIT B INJECTION 1ML may interact with blood thinners (warfarin), antibiotics (chloramphenicol, tetracycline), gout medicine (colchicine), anti-diabetics (metformin), anti-ulcer drugs (cimetidine, omeprazole), anti-cancer drugs (methotrexate), fits medicines (phenytoin), chemotherapy medicines (raltitrexed), and antiparasitics (pyrimethamine).
Drug-Food Interaction: Excessive alcohol consumption reduces absorption and increases the elimination of folic acid. Hence, please avoid alcohol while using PACEVIT B INJECTION 1ML.
Drug-Disease Interaction: Use PACEVIT B INJECTION 1ML with medical advice if you have malabsorption syndrome (difficulty absorbing nutrition from food), diabetes, gout, liver/kidney diseases, stomach ulcers, and allergic reactions to medicines.
